Summary: | Next-generation networks promise to provide a richer set of applications for the end user, creating a network platform that enables the rapid creation of new services. Significant progress has been made in the standardization of NGN architecture and protocols, but little progress has been made on open APIs. This article outlines the importance of open APIs and the current achievements of the standards bodies. It concludes with a brief set of issues that standards bodies must resolve in relation to these APIs. |
